PlayBadminton Safety
It is important that before you attend any activity, club or venue you have gone through the appropriate checks and made sure it is safe to do so.
Child Protection Policy
A good activity provider will welcome questions about its activities and the safety of its environment. It will have a child protection policy and you should be told what to do if your child has any concerns. Ideally, there should be a club welfare officer who will answer any questions you might have.
Criminal Records Bureau Check
You need to be sure that the staff and volunteers who will be working with your child are suitable. Ask if the club undertakes enhanced level CRB (Criminal Records Bureau) checks on coaches and helpers.
Training and Education
Appropriate training and education ensures that everyone working with participants is aware of how to make the activities enjoyable and safe. Ask if coaches, instructors and volunteers have undertaken training through a recognised National Governing Body, or achieved a formal qualification in the sport or activity.
Club Accreditation
Find out whether the activity provider has an accreditation award such as the BADMINTON England certification. This shows that it has achieved a recognised minimum standard that ensures it provides a high quality experience.
